    US based Newmont is in top spot, reporting 2,758 koz of gold produced in the first half of the year. Newmont has operations in Africa, Australia, South America and the US – where Nevada Gold Mines, the world’s largest gold mining complex, is a joint venture with Barrick Gold.

    In second place is Canada’s Barrick, which produced 2,099 koz of gold in H122 from its global operations. Barrick’s CEO Mark Bristow said this month that inflation “isn’t going away in a hurry” and has famously called for the industry to consolidate.

    Agnico Eagle, which closed a $10 billion merger with Kirkland Lake Gold early this year, takes third place, with 1,547 koz of gold produced from its operations in Canada, Australia, Finland and Mexico. Following the merger to the two Canadian companies, Agnico continued to operate under the same same.

    Johannesburg-headquartered Goldfields produced 1,129 koz of gold from its operations in Africa, Australia and Peru. Goldfields grabbed headlines this year when it announced it was buying Canada’s Yamana Gold in an all-share deal worth $6.7 billion, which makes it the world’s fourth largest gold producer.

    In fifth place is South Africa’s Anglogold Ashanti, which produced 1,110 koz of gold in the fist half from its operations in Africa, Australia and the Americas. Early this year shareholders of Canada’s Corvus Gold voted in favour of AngloGold Ashanti taking control of the company in a deal estimated at $370 million.

    Australia’s biggest gold miner, Newcrest, is the sixth largest producer with 1,097 koz produced at its operations in the home country, Papua New Guinea and Canada. Late last year, Newcrest acquired Pretium Resources in a $2.8 billion deal, making it the owner of Brucejack in British Columbia, one of the world’s highest grade gold mines.

    Canada’s Kinross Gold is number seven, producing 824 koz of gold from its operations in the Americas and Mauritania in the first half 2022. Kinross suspended its operations in Russia in early March to comply with Western sanctions against Moscow over its invasion of Ukraine.     Australia’s Northern Star Resources produced 791 koz of gold from its operations in Australia and Alaska. In 2020, Northern Star bought Newmont’s 50% stake in Western Australia’s Kalgoorlie iconic Super Pit mine and its associated assets for $775 million.

    Endeavour Mining is the only European miner to make our list – the UK company produced 734 koz of gold from its mines in Côte d’Ivoire, Burkina Faso and Senegal. In April, Endeavour said it will proceed with the expansion of the Sabodala-Massawa mine complex in Senegal.

    Rounding out the top 10 is South Africa’s Harmony Gold, which produced 691 koz of gold from its assets in the home country and Papua New Guinea.
